Prep Time:120 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:135 mins
Servings: 12

Ingredients

  • 1 cup Warm water
  • 1 third cup Honey
  • 2 tablespoons Butter (softened)
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1.5 cups Whole wheat flour
  • 1.5 cups All-purpose flour
  • 2 tablespoons Dry milk powder
  • 2.25 teaspoons Active dry yeast

Directions

Step 1

Add warm water, honey, softened butter, and salt to the bread machine pan in the order recommended by the manufacturer.

Step 2

Add the whole wheat flour, all-purpose flour, and dry milk powder to the pan.

Step 3

Make a small well in the center of the flour and add the active dry yeast, ensuring it does not come into direct contact with the water.

Step 4

Set the bread machine to the 'Dough' cycle and start. Allow the machine to knead and rise the dough as per the cycle settings.

Step 5

When the dough cycle is complete, transfer the dough to a lightly floured surface. Gently punch down the dough to remove any air bubbles.

Step 6

Divide the dough into 12 equal pieces. Shape each piece into a smooth round ball and place them on a greased or parchment-lined baking sheet, spaced slightly apart.

Step 7

Cover the rolls loosely with a clean kitchen towel and let them rise in a warm place for about 30 minutes, or until they have doubled in size.

Step 8

Meanwhile, pre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 9

Bake the rolls in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the tops are golden brown.

Step 10

Remove the rolls from the oven and let them cool slightly on a wire rack before serving.
